What is the easiest way to measure a distance at an intersecting point at the surface of a sphere?

Often I need to measure the projecting distance of a cylinder (pipe) through a sphere (or cone).
Or to make this question easier, how do I measure where a line intersects the surface of a sphere in a 3D model. The true length would best be seen in the front elevation view.

To this point I have been using the subtract solid command to make it easier to snap to the surface of the intersection point but I am sure, there must be an easier way to measure this distance or place a dimension (in order to get a distance).
